France - Petroleum and Natural Gas Extraction Support Activities Wages and Salaries

Since 2014, France Petroleum and Natural Gas Extraction Support Activities Wages and Salaries decreased by 4.3% year on year. With €133.1 Million in 2019, the country was number 4 among other countries in Petroleum and Natural Gas Extraction Support Activities Wages and Salaries. France is overtaken by Denmark, which was number 3 at €152.8 Million and is followed by Italy at €94.9 Million. Norway lead the ranking with €2,526 Million in 2019, an increase of 2.9% compared to 2018. Denmark recorded the best 5 years average growth at +5.1% per year, while Hungary recorded the worst performance at -15.7% per year.
